WebIn 2002, the Education IRA was renamed the Coverdell Education Savings Account. These accounts work very much like a 529 plan, offering tax-free investment growth and tax-free withdrawals when the funds are spent on qualified education expenses. Your Coverdell contributions over the years to save up are the cost basis. So, if you put in $50k and are taking out $80k, only earnings of $30k is taxable. WebGross distributions from a 529 or a Coverdell ESA reported in Box 1 include both earnings (reported in box 2) and basis (reported in box 3). The distribution is normally not taxable if it was used to pay for qualified education expenses, if it was transferred between trustees, or if it was rolled over into another qualified program within 60 days.
